A recent leakage coming from Nintendo’s US offices have started rumours that the Japanese manufacturer might be planning to release an Android-based tablet in the very near future.

An alleged Nintendo software engineer named Nando Monterazo published a number of tweets saying that he is currently exploring a tablet by Nintendo has a fully modified UI whose base is Google’s Android. He also added that the tablet’s games will be geared towards educational purposes but will feature a number of familiar Nintendo characters.

Monterazo’s tweet has now been taken down (possibly by Nintendo), which somehow makes this story a bit more interesting. At present, the closest thing that Nintendo has for a tablet would be its controller for the Wii U, so in case this rumour is true, it wouldn’t be surprising if the tablet would use similar components from the Wii U controller.

Nonetheless, a Nintendo tablet would play an important role on the company’s reputation as well as in its finances, especially when its current Wii U gaming console isn’t performing very well in the market.
